A zero point and accidental errors for published values of [Fe/H] for cool giants.

TAYLOR B.J.

Abstract (from CDS):

This paper is one of a series based on published values of [Fe/H] for late-type evolved stars. Only values of [Fe/H] from high-dispersion spectroscopy or related techniques are used. The narrative in this paper begins at a point where mean values of [Fe/H] have been derived for ε Vir, α Boo, β Gem, and the Hyades giants. By using these stars as standard stars when necessary, a zero-point data base is assembled. This data base is then expanded into its final version by correcting and adding additional data in a step-by-step process. As that process proceeds, data comparisons are used to establish rms errors. Derived rms errors per datum are found to be about 0.10-0.12dex, and they appear to be too large to be explained by line-to-line scatter and temperature effects.
